The Problem
You're organizing an event — a wedding, conference, team outing, or birthday party. You want everyone's photos in one place.
Common solutions that don't work well:
- WhatsApp groups: compressed images, messy, hard to download all
- Google Photos shared albums: everyone needs a Google account
- Google Forms: uploaders need Google login, ugly interface
- Airdrop/Bluetooth: only works nearby, one-at-a-time

Step-by-Step Setup
1. Create a Google Drive Folder
In your Google Drive, create a folder like "Wedding Photos - Raj & Priya 2026".
2. Connect to DriveWidget
- Sign up at drivewidget.com (free)
- Click New Connection
- Authorize Google Drive access
- Select your photos folder
3. Create an Upload Widget
Go to the widget settings:
- Title: "Share Your Photos!"
- Allowed types: Images only (JPG, PNG, HEIC)
- Max file size: 50MB (covers high-res photos)
- Form fields: None needed (or add optional "Your Name" field)
4. Get Your Upload Link
Copy the public upload page URL. It looks like:
https://api.drivewidget.com/u/wedding-photos
5. Create a QR Code
Use any free QR code generator to create a code from your upload link. Print it and place at tables, entrance, or photo booth.
What Attendees See
- Scan QR code → opens upload page in browser
- Tap "Upload" or drag photos
- See progress bar → "Uploaded to Google Drive!"
- Done — no account, no app, no login
After the Event
All photos are in your Google Drive folder. You can:
- Share the Drive folder with attendees to view/download
- Download all at once as a ZIP
- Organize into subfolders by date
